To Whom It May Concern:

Pursuant to the Colorado Open Records Act, I hereby request the following records:

Any and all written documents that include, but are not limited to, policies, procedures, training manuals, talking points and slideshows that include the topic of non-discrimination or anti-bullying policies regarding LGBT identified students. This includes, but is not limited to, policies on the use of restroom and locker room facilities. Please limit this request to documents that were generated over the past two years as well as documents, such as policies, that are in effect now.

Any and all communications or questions requested from education institutions regarding the Department of Justice’ 2016 Joint Guidance on Transgender Students (“Dear Colleague Letter”) or Trump’s 2017 “Dear Colleague Letter”. For reference, these letters are available at the following URLs respectively: https://www2.ed.gov/about/offices/list/ocr/letters/colleague-201605-title-ix-transgender.pdf https://www.justice.gov/opa/press-release/file/941551/download

Any and all records, reports or documents sent to districts that regard student sexual health education.

Finally, I request any and all memos, letters, policies and guidelines sent to schools in the last five years that outline policies regarding transgender or gender non-conforming students. This includes, but is not limited to, the use of restroom and locker room facilities.

The requested documents will be made available to the general public, and this request is not being made for commercial purposes.

In the event that there are fees, I would be grateful if you would inform me of the total charges in advance of fulfilling my request. I would prefer the request filled electronically, by e-mail attachment if available or CD-ROM if not.

Thank you in advance for your anticipated cooperation in this matter. I look forward to receiving your response to this request within 3 business days, as the statute requires.

Your request for “Any and all communications or questions requested from education institutions regarding the Department of Justice’ 2016 Joint Guidance on Transgender Students (“Dear Colleague Letter”) or Trump’s 2017 “Dear Colleague Letter” is extremely broad. An initial search for all emails to the department with the term transgender students resulted in more than 10,000 emails. It will take multiple hours to sort through these emails in order to provide you with emails from just educational institutions, as you requested. Would you be willing to narrow your request by selecting certain staff for whom you would like us to search communications, and/or would you be willing to provide us with domain names of the education institutions in which you are interested?
